## Formula sandbox tuning

User-supplied formulas in Gridmoor execute inside a restricted interpreter with hard ceilings on time, memory, and call depth. Reviewers should confirm any change to these ceilings is justified in the PR description, since raising them widens the abuse surface. Defaults were chosen from production traces. The current limits are as follows.

limits module of tafog-fawip:
WEIGHTS = {
    "julix": 57,
    "lamys": 992,
    "kasvan": 209,
    "quenok": 750,
    "alddor": 259,
    "oliath": 1009,
    "wenix": 815,
}

Building access: quiet room, top floor — Tarnwell Point. The quiet room on Level 9 remains available to night shift staff, but the lifts stop serving that floor after 22:00, so use stairwell B. Lights are motion-activated and will dim after twenty minutes of stillness; wave at the ceiling sensor to reset them. Keep the door closed to preserve the climate settings. The door keypad accepts the current night access code, shown below.

door code, fawep-hawep: bdg-C-22

Handover note for the incoming contractor on Glimmerkit, our shared component library. Ines, versioning follows strict semver: any prop removal is a major bump, no exceptions, and release candidates soak for one week before promotion. Never publish from a local machine; the pipeline signs every release. The full release checklist and deprecation policy live on the internal page here.

runbook for tajep-yahig: https://artifactory.lumictech.corp/repo